Abstract:With the increase of exploration depth,formation pressure rises and rock hardness increases,screw drilling tools often experience lateral whirl,longitudinal bounce,torsional vibration and stick-slip phenomena,which limit the popularization and application of impact screw drilling tools.In order to study the sealing characteristics and parameter sensitivity of the transmission shaft assembly under the coupling effect of high temperature,high speed and reciprocating motion,the sealing characteristics of star rings,O-rings and combined rings under the same working conditions were compared,and the contact pressure distribution of different sealing rings in static and dynamic sealing states was obtained.The best sealing ring structure was determined according to the method of determining the contact pressure of the main sealing surface.Based on this structure,the sensitive parameters of the groove were studied,and the influence of the groove shape,position,number and width on the sealing characteristics of the combined ring was discussed.The results show that the sealing effect of the combined ring is far better than that of the O-ring and the star ring.When the groove shape is isosceles triangle and the number of grooves is 3,the sealing performance is the best,and the groove position in the middle is the most reasonable.In the static and dynamic sealing state,the contact pressure of main sealing surface increases with the increase of the groove width,while the contact pressure of secondary sealing surface in the static sealing state and the stress of O-ring is almost unchanged.
